- Best phone and Budget AI phone.
The Selfie cameras and rear cameras were good. This phone also have NFC. Processor looks trash but, better than the Samsung Galaxy J6+ but worst than oppo a7n. Buy either Vivo Y95, oppo a7n instead of samsung galaxy j6+
Pros- AI Camera
- Dual Camera
- Colourful design with flying colours.
- Notch and design.
Cons- Slow processor. Better than Samsung Galaxy J6+

In this case, to determine the score we evaluate 5 general aspects:
- Design and screen
- Hardware and performance
- Camera
- Connectivity
- Battery
Once these 5 factors have been rated, we introduce the price variable. This means that any two devices with the same ratings get a different Ki score for quality vs price.
Even a device objectively worse than another may have a higher Ki score if it has a better price.
The Ki varies as time goes by. As new devices with better specifications enter the market the Ki score of older devices will go down, always being compensated of their decrease in price.
